Output 8589d2427911ee4f6ea3068fbb630135280ebbcb02dd20cab04e65fab2e28930:1

value
310278
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e3b9e471896b63a536f165b19b2f8cb1e063f810b9a87129141d08c5eee80f6
address
bc1ptcaeu3ccj6mr55m0zed3nvhcev0qv0uppwdgwy53g8ggchhwsrmqfmv4q7
transaction
8589d2427911ee4f6ea3068fbb630135280ebbcb02dd20cab04e65fab2e28930
spent
true